Objectives



 

Development and operation of different systems for heating and controlling the plasma parameters for the large fusion experiments of the IPP;
support for the enhancements of the JET heating systems; collaboration on the development of heating systems for ITER.

The fusion experiments of the IPP are heated by three methods:

Whereas the first two methods heat both ions and electrons, only electrons are heated by ECRH.
